Question : What is marketing

Correct Answer: Delivering value to customers. Seeks

to:Discover needs and wants of customers Satisfy them

Question : Exchange

Correct Answer: Money for goods and services

Question : Requirements for marketing to occur

Correct Answer: 1. Two or more parties with unsatisfied

needs

  • Desire and ability to satisfy these needs
  • A way for the parties to communicate
  • Something to exchange

Question : Target Market

Correct Answer: A group of people or organizations for

which an organization designs, implements, and maintains a marketing mix intended to meet the needs of that group, resulting in mutually satisfying exchanges

Question : The Marketing Mix (the 4 P's)

Correct Answer: These are Controllable marketing mix

factors-production-promotion-price-place

Question : customer value proposition

Correct Answer: a cluster of benefits that an organization

promises customers to satisfy their needs

Question : Environmental Forces

Correct Answer: the uncontrollable social, economic,

technological, competitive, and regulatory forces that affect the results of a marketing decision

Question : Marketing program

Correct Answer: a plan that integrates the marketing mix to

provide a good, service, or idea to prospective buyers

Question : Marketing segments

Correct Answer: relatively homogeneous groups of

prospective buyers that have common needs and will respond similarly to a marketing action

Question : Production era

Correct Answer: In the early 1900s, businesses refined

production process and created greater efficiencies

Question : Sales era

Correct Answer: company emphasizes selling because of

increased competition

Question : Marketing concept era

Correct Answer: era that emphasized satisfying customer

needs with a carefully developed marketing mix. While achieving the org's goals.

Question : Customer relationship era

Correct Answer: firms seek continuously to satisfy the high

expectations of customers
